What the veterinarian does
You describe your pet’s itching, the medication your pet takes now and how well it is working, and add photos of the skin if you have them. The veterinarian reviews the case, messages you with any questions, and, when it is appropriate, sends the renewed prescription to the pharmacy you choose.
This consultation is for pets that a veterinarian has already diagnosed and started on treatment. If your pet has never been treated for this, the veterinarian will tell you whether an online assessment is enough or whether an in-person examination is needed first. If it cannot be handled online, the fee is refunded.
What can be prescribed
- Daily anti-itch tablet for allergic itching
- Daily allergy medication: capsules for dogs or an oral liquid for cats
The veterinarian chooses what is appropriate for your pet. Telepets veterinarians do not prescribe controlled substances. Medication is paid to the pharmacy at its price; Telepets adds no markup.
